How to Say "Cool" in Korean (멋있어 / 쿨해): Style, Personality & Context

멋있어

meosseo

Quick answer

To say someone looks or acts cool in Korean, say 멋있어 (meosseo) casually — it covers both appearance and behavior.

Common forms

RegisterHangulRomanizationNote
casual멋있어meosseoThe go-to 'cool' for style, attitude, or an impressive action — all-purpose.
polite멋있어요meosseoyoPolite form — use with people you're not super close to.
exclamation멋있다!meositda!Spontaneous 'that's cool / he's cool!' reaction — very natural.
personality cool (laid-back, unbothered)쿨해kulhaeFrom English 'cool' — specifically means laid-back, not clingy, or easygoing about something.

How it changes by relationship

야, 완전 멋있다!

Ya, wanjeon meositda!

complimenting a friend's action or style: Hey, that's totally cool! — spontaneous and genuine.

무대 위에서 진짜 멋있어.

Mudae wi-eseo jinjja meosseo.

about an idol or celebrity: They're so cool on stage — describing a performance.

걔 되게 쿨해, 질투 같은 거 안 해.

Gyae doege kulhae, jealtu gateun geo an hae.

describing personality / attitude: She's really chill — she doesn't get jealous.

정말 멋있어요!

Jeongmal meosseoyo!

polite compliment: You're / that's really cool! — warm and polite.

Examples

저 가수 진짜 멋있어요.

Jeo gasu jinjja meosseoyo.

That singer is really cool.

와, 멋있다! 어디서 배웠어?

Wa, meositda! Eodiseo baewosseo?

Wow, that's cool! Where did you learn that?

그 사람 쿨한 것 같아.

Geu saram kulhan geot gata.

That person seems pretty chill.

Usage note

멋있어 covers both physical coolness (stylish appearance) and impressive actions, whereas 쿨해 (kulhae) specifically refers to personality — being chill, not overthinking, or being cool about a situation. Mixing them up doesn't cause offense but can sound slightly off.

FAQ

What's the difference between 멋있어 and 잘생겼어?

잘생겼어 (jalsaenggyeosseo) is specifically about being physically handsome. 멋있어 (meosseo) covers cool style, personality, or impressiveness — you'd say 멋있어 about someone's skill or fashion, not just their face.

How do I say 'that's so cool' in Korean?

진짜 멋있다 (jinjja meositda) is natural and common. 대박 (daebak) can also mean 'awesome / so cool' as a reaction.

Is 쿨해 a loanword?

Yes — 쿨해 comes directly from the English 'cool' and is used in the personality sense (laid-back, easygoing), not for physical appearance.
